亚洲精品久久久中文字幕-亚洲精品久久片久久-亚洲精品久久青草-亚洲精品久久婷婷爱久久婷婷-亚洲精品久久午夜香蕉

您的位置:首頁技術文章
文章詳情頁

python exit出錯原因整理

瀏覽:13日期:2022-07-12 18:07:19

Python程序有兩種退出方式: os._exit() 和 sys.exit()。我查了一下這兩種方式的區別。

os._exit() 會直接將python程序終止,之后的所有代碼都不會執行。 sys.exit() 會拋出一個異常: SystemExit,如果這個異常沒有被捕獲,那么python解釋器將會退出。如果有捕獲該異常的代碼,那么這些

代碼還是會執行。

例如

import ostry: os._exit(0)except: print(’Program is dead.’)

這個print是不會打印的,因為沒有異常被捕獲。

import systry: sys.exit(0)except: print(’Program is dead.’)finally: print(’clean-up’)

這里兩個print都可以打印,因為sys.exit()拋出了異常。

結論

使用sys.exit()來退出程序比較優雅,調用它能引發SystemExit異常,然后我們可以捕獲這個異常做些清理工作。而os._exit()將python解

釋器直接退出,后面的語句都不會執行。一般情況下用sys.exit()就行;os._exit()可以在os.fork()產生的子進程里使用。

到此這篇關于python exit出錯原因整理的文章就介紹到這了,更多相關python exit出錯是什么原因內容請搜索好吧啦網以前的文章或繼續瀏覽下面的相關文章希望大家以后多多支持好吧啦網!

標簽: Python 編程
相關文章:
主站蜘蛛池模板: 国产精彩视频在线 | 久久精品亚洲精品一区 | 香蕉香蕉国产片一级一级毛片 | 四虎91视频 | 天天拍拍天天爽免费视频 | 欧美黄色性生活视频 | 日韩一级免费视频 | 可以看黄色的网址 | 美女久久久 | 韩国深夜福利视频19禁在线观看 | 国产精彩视频在线观看 | 99热精品国产三级在线观看 | 一级特黄aa大片免费 | 一级中文字幕 | 尤蜜视频在线观看播放 | 你懂的网站在线播放 | 久久精品一区二区三区日韩 | 欧美三级在线看中文字幕 | 国产高清免费在线 | 免费国产一区二区三区四区 | 一级毛片免费观看久 | 免费播放国产性色生活片 | 欧美一级暴毛片 | 中文字幕日韩一区二区三区不卡 | 一木道一二三区精品 | 国产免费一区二区三区香蕉精 | 4444在线观看片 | 亚洲黄色免费网址 | 特级黄一级播放 | 亚洲欧美视频在线 | 日本 亚洲 欧美 | 国产毛片黄片 | 成人a区| 免费人成在线观看视频不卡 | 亚洲在线a | 久久国产精品高清一区二区三区 | 妖精www视频在线观看高清 | 欧美日韩国产综合视频一区二区三区 | 久久日本精品久久久久久 | 国产精品永久免费视频观看 | 国产一区二卡三区四区 |